Blue Heeles attracted an audience of 1.6 million people for this episode.
Tess Gallagher is mentioned as being part of the search however, since Caroline Craig left the show, she does not actually appear.
After months of planning, this episode went to air live across the country with a half hour special before it with interviews about how it was done.
Paul Bishop does not appear because he had theatre committments on the night that the episode went to air. However, his voice was recorded and is used during the flashback to the search for Matt Procter's son, when Ben radios the station.
